Troubleshooting
In general, refer any service problems to your Mark Levinson dealer. Before con-
tacting your dealer, however, check to see if the problem is listed here. If it is, try
the suggested solutions. If none of these solves the problem, contact your Mark
Levinson dealer.
1.
THE Nº36 WON’T FUNCTION, AND THE DISPLAY IS DARK.
✓
The standby button on the front panel isn’t turned on.
✓
The Nº36 isn’t plugged into the AC mains.
✓
The wall socket, adapter, or extension cord is faulty.
✓
There’s a tripped circuit breaker or blown fuse in the wall
outlet’s circuit.
✓
A fuse is blown in your Nº36 (contact your Mark Levinson
dealer).
2.
THE DISPLAY IS LIT, BUT THERE IS NO OUTPUT
✓
The proper source isn’t selected on your Nº36.
✓
The proper source isn’t selected on your preamplifier.
✓
The interconnecting cables are connected incorrectly or are
faulty.
3.
THE Nº36 DISPLAY READS “CD1 OFF.”
✓
The selected digital source component for Input #1 is turned
off.
✓
The digital connection between the digital source and the Nº36
is faulty.
4.
THE LINKED FUNCTIONS DON’T WORK.
✓
The Link cable is disconnected, or is connected incorrectly.
✓
The digital audio cable is disconnected, or is connected incor-
rectly (in which case the Display Link function would continue
to work correctly, but none of the others would work).
✓
Try turning off/disconnecting AC power from both the transport
and the Nº36. After several seconds, restore AC power to the
digital processor,
then
turn on the Nº31’s
main power
switch.
✓
You may have older versions of the system software in your as-
sociated Mark Levinson components which do not fully support
all Linked functions. Contact your Mark Levinson dealer with the
model and serial numbers of your Mark Levinson components.
If needed, new EPROMs will be provided at no charge.
5.
MY Nº36 KEEPS DISPLAYING “6 DB PAD!” WHENEVER I CHANGE IN-
PUTS.
✓
Your processor is reminding you that it is in the automatic gain-
matching mode required (as a default) by the HDCD license. To
defeat this mode and reminder (and improve the sound of your
Nº36), follow the instructions on page 12 of this manual.
